56
57 /**
58 * A handle for managing updates for derived page data on edit, import, purge, etc.
59 *
60 * @note Avoid direct usage of DerivedPageDataUpdater.
61 *
62 * @todo Define interfaces for the different use cases of DerivedPageDataUpdater, particularly
63 * providing access to post-PST content and ParserOutput to callbacks during revision creation,
64 * which currently use WikiPage::prepareContentForEdit, and allowing updates to be triggered on
65 * purge, import, and undeletion, which currently use WikiPage::doEditUpdates() and
66 * Content::getSecondaryDataUpdates().
67 *
68 * DerivedPageDataUpdater instances are designed to be cached inside a WikiPage instance,
69 * and re-used by callback code over the course of an update operation. It's a stepping stone
70 * one the way to a more complete refactoring of WikiPage.
71 *
72 * When using a DerivedPageDataUpdater, the following life cycle must be observed:
73 * grabCurrentRevision (optional), prepareContent (optional), prepareUpdate (required
74 * for doUpdates). getCanonicalParserOutput, getSlots, and getSecondaryDataUpdates
75 * require prepareContent or prepareUpdate to have been called first, to initialize the
76 * DerivedPageDataUpdater.
77 *
78 * @see docs/pageupdater.txt for more information.
79 *
80 * MCR migration note: this replaces the relevant methods in WikiPage, and covers the use cases
81 * of PreparedEdit.
82 *
83 * @internal
84 *
85 * @since 1.32
86 * @ingroup Page
87 */
